Saltbreaker "Portal": Multilayered sound world


Saltbreaker is an ambient project from Michigan that blends folk, post-rock, and new age influences to create immersive, organic soundscapes. Their music layers acoustic and electric instrumentation with atmospheric textures, using the human voice as a textural element rather than a lyrical one.



"Portal" invites the listener into a rich sonic world, where live instrumentation—guitar, piano, harp, clarinet, and violin—intertwines with the ambient pulse of Detroit’s streets. The standout feature is an improvisational clarinet performance by Jeffrey Thiele, which flows unpredictably, like wind weaving through an urban landscape.
